[Synthesis]
General procedure for the synthesis of methyl 4-(4-fluorophenyl)pyrimidine-2-carboxylate from 2-chloro-4-(4-fluorophenyl)-pyrimidine: In a 50 mL pressure vial, a methanol (20 mL) solution of 2-chloro-4-(4-fluorophenyl)pyrimidine (1 g, 4.79 mmol) was mixed with PdCl2 (dppf) (0.070 g, 0.096 mmol) and triethylamine (1.336 mL, 9.59 mmol) were mixed. The mixture was pressurized with carbon monoxide (60 psi) and the reaction was stirred at 100 °C for 15 hours. Upon completion of the reaction, the mixture was partitioned between 300 mL of ethyl acetate and 300 mL of water, the organic phase was washed with brine, dried over anhydrous Na2SO4, filtered and concentrated. The residue was separated by chromatography on a Grace Reveleris 40 g silica gel column, using a hexane solution of 0-100% ethyl acetate (flow rate 30 mL/min) as eluent, to afford the title compound, methyl 4-(4-fluorophenyl)pyrimidine-2-carboxylate (1.428 g, 6.15 mmol, 64.1% yield), as a brown solid.MS (ESI+ ) m/z 233.0 (M + H)+; 1H NMR (300 MHz, DMSO-d6) δ 9.02 (d, J = 5.4 Hz, 1H), 8.34 (dd, J = 9.1, 5.5 Hz, 2H), 8.29 (d, J = 5.4 Hz, 1H), 7.43 (t, J = 8.9 Hz, 2H), 3.95 (s, 3H). |
